What happens if you're in survival mode?

Survival mode is another term for continuous, unresolved stress, also known as chronic stress. All human beings have experienced stress at one point or another, but in survival mode, stress has been prolonged to a degree where a person feels unable to relax. Parts of the brain associated with fear are overactive.

Why do people live in survival mode?

Stressful stimuli cause a physiological and psychological response called our survival mode. This mode involves the release of stress hormones and the activation of our stress-response systems. Our mind and body become focused on combating danger. Survival mode originally evolved to help us handle threats.

What happens to the brain when it switches to survival mode?

When a person experiences or witnesses a traumatic event, their brain enters what is called survival mode. In order to help them survive, their brain will switch off certain parts and turn on others, such as heightening senses and creating more adrenaline.

What is the 3 hour rule in survival?

Normally, the rule of threes contains the following: You can survive three minutes without breathable air (unconsciousness), or in icy water. You can survive three hours in a harsh environment (extreme heat or cold). You can survive three days without drinkable water.

What is the 3 day survival rule?

Survival Rule of 3 and Survival Priorities

You can survive for 3 Hours without shelter in a harsh environment (unless in icy water) You can survive for 3 Days without water (if sheltered from a harsh environment) You can survive for 3 Weeks without food (if you have water and shelter)
